Wall Surface Maintenance
Evaluating walls for any flaws and immediately resolving them with required fixings is vital for achieving a smooth and remarkable paint work. Before beginning the paint process, thoroughly examine the walls for cracks, openings, damages, or any other damages that can affect the final result.
Begin by filling out any kind of cracks or holes with spackling compound, allowing it to dry totally before sanding it down to develop a smooth surface. For bigger dents or harmed areas, take into consideration using joint compound to make certain a seamless repair.
Furthermore, check for any loose paint or wallpaper that may need to be gotten rid of. Remove any peeling pa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face area to develop an uniform structure.
It's also necessary to evaluate for water damage, as this can result in mold and mildew development and affect the adhesion of the new paint. Resolve any type of water discolorations or mold with the proper cleaning remedies prior to waging the painting process.
Cleaning and Surface Prep Work
To make certain a beautiful and well-prepared surface area for painting, the next action includes thoroughly cleansing and prepping the wall surfaces. Begin by dusting the wall surfaces with a microfiber fabric or a duster to get rid of any type of loose dust, webs, or debris.

After cleaning, it is important to check the wall surfaces for any kind of splits, openings, or flaws. These should be loaded with spackling compound and sanded smooth as soon as dry. Sanding the walls gently with fine-grit sandpaper will also aid develop an uniform surface for paint.
Priming and Insulation
Prior to paint, the wall surfaces must be keyed to guarantee correct attachment of the paint and taped to safeguard nearby surface areas from roaming brushstrokes. Priming serves as an essential action in the paint procedure, especially for brand-new drywall or surfaces that have actually been patched or fixed. It assists secure the wall surface, developing a smooth and consistent surface area for the paint to follow. In addition, guide can improve the sturdiness and insurance coverage of the paint, ultimately causing a much more expert and resilient finish.
When it concerns taping, utilizing pain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and various other surface areas you want to protect is important to attain clean and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is developed to be conveniently applied and gotten rid of without damaging the underlying surface area or leaving behind any deposit.
